The Nottawa Multiple Listing Service (MLS), is one of the most important tools that Nottawa Realtors use in their daily activities. Property listings in the MLS are maintained in a near-real-time databases and are available to the members.As Nottawa property is listed for sale, sold, or changes such as price occur the MLS is updated. Some Multiple Listing Services display the property listings to the general public online with the much of information that each property offers. This gives the Nottawa consumer the opportunity to search for Nottawa properties and REALTORS online. In addition to compiling and distributing property information the MLS brings its members together to influence the local real estate community.

There are of course other variables that can affect Nottawa house values. These variables are dictated by the situations of a given buyer or seller. Typical behaviors usually show the following trends. First, you may have Nottawa sellers who have patience and are willing to wait for the right buyer therefore they will get their asking price though it may be slightly inflated. Then there are those who have already moved into a new Nottawa home and they are paying for both homes so they need to get their old house off their hands and they will often be willing to go lower than market value if they have to. Conversely, we have buyers. They too have an impact on house values. This is usually displayed by their willingness to pay either more or less than current house values.
